what is up with this?

I just want to post up to share an experience relating to my search for a JDM import. I emailed Eric at www.hj61.com. I asked him to provide a few basic details regarding the vehicles he has for sale and answer a few basic questions regarding the maintenance and services he provides and his experience with land cruisers. He declined to answer my questions via email and asked that we speak on the phone. I politely responded that I would like to have a record of his answers to my questions and that I would discuss the possible purchase of a vehicle on the phone with him after he had answered my preliminary round of questions and I had had a chance to decide whether or not to proceed further in my dealings with him.

Is that unreasonable on my part?

This was his email response in its entirety:

I suspect that you are not a legimate purchasor.

What is that? Neither Louis (Adventure Imports), Marko (Outback), Wayne (Luxury Imports), Michael (Rising Sun) or Barry (Mustang Imports) have taken issue with answering a few basic questions via email and not one of them has had the audacity to accuse me of not being a "legitimate purchaser" simply because I wanted a few basic questions answered via email.

I don't know what anyone else's experience has been with Eric at HJ61.COM but I for one am offended by what I take to be his blatant lack of professionalism in accusing me of not being a "legitimate purchaser".

I told him that I do not appreciate his absurd accusation and that I would share this experience with others.

Now he has just threatened me if I share my experience on this forum and say anything untrue about him. Here is his email in its entirety:

If you say something untrue about me, that is meant to cause my reputation harm ...you will be commiting "slander".
You don't want to go there.

What is this guy's problem? Am I at fault here in any way for being a cautious and prudent shopper?

I don't doubt that these import dealers have to deal with insincere inquiries all the time, but hey, they're selling vehicles - it comes with the territory. In my mind, if you want to be in the business, you have to accept the fact that not everyone is actually going to buy.

And never tell someone they're not legitimate. That is just plain offensive.

Not odd at all if he advertised his services on the internet, and included an email address for you to correspond with.

You must be new to the internet, I have agreed to terms to buy and sell vehicles entirely by email, I have done this at least four times, always contingent on meeting and inspecting.

All details about maintenance, service, sale price, etc. were agreed to, before I ever spoke to anyone. Sure makes it easy. Meet up, inspect to make sure vehicle is as the seller stated, no negotiating, as that is already done, exchange money for a title, done.
